Quoted from bigguybbr:I think it is a CR2032 coin battery on Spike 2 CPUs. Probably only needs to be swapped every 5-10 years. You likely don't need to yet.
If you take off your translight you should see it in the center of your CPU board. The complete swap probably only takes less than a minute, which is probably why there isn't an in depth guide.

I have also experienced TP multiball weirdness on my Premium since updating to code 1.5. It's not every time. During TP multiball when you drain down to the last couple of balls, the trough eject shoots them back up to reload the Turtle Van, but for some reason the diverter is not activated and the balls keep coming back into play well after the ball save has stopped, even well into single ball play. When I shoot them back up the right ramp though, it usually catches them at that point.
I've noticed this also during Ninja Pizza MB, particularly when I have 3 gummy bear toppings (which adds a ball for each) and the 3 extra balls come from the turtle van, not the trough (since there are only 2 down inside the trough). It's very strange. Glad it's not just me.

Quoted from Dustwel:Was there ever any consensus or guide on how to handle the sword shooter rod issues? I’m on my second one and it only plunges halfway up the lane. Installing it was a PITA due to the screw closest to the side wall being tough to access. I’ve read you can swap the spring which I can do, just seems ridiculous it wouldn’t work out of the box.
Different spring didn't help me. The problem is that they used the same standard length shooter rod shaft inside the katana, but as you can see the katana sticks out further from the machine than normal, hence a greater distance from the ball when the tip is at rest. To combat this, I removed one of the washers from around the outer spring near the hilt. That shortens the position of the rod tip to the ball ever so slightly, which gives me plenty of power to make it all the way around. Granted I am pulling it back harder than a normal plunger, but once you get the feel it works much better. Hope that helps.
